Blepharoplasty (Eyelid Surgery)
Overview
Blepharoplasty, or eyelid surgery, is performed to rejuvenate the upper or lower eyelids by removing excess skin and fat. This procedure restores a more alert, youthful appearance and can also improve vision when sagging eyelids interfere with sight. How It Works
For the upper eyelids, incisions are made along the natural crease to remove extra skin and fat. For the lower eyelids, incisions are either hidden below the lash line or made inside the eyelid (transconjunctival) to address puffiness and under-eye bags without visible scars.
Ideal Candidates
- Droopy upper eyelids that make you look tired or aged
- Puffy lower eyelids or under-eye bags
- Good overall health and no serious eye conditions
- Realistic expectations for improvement.

Recovery
Swelling and bruising last 1–2 weeks. You may return to non-strenuous activities after 5–7 days. Most patients see their final result in 4–6 weeks, with continued improvement over time.
